Understanding AWS Cloud Costs for Oracle Workloads

Migrating business workloads to the AWS cloud can bring numerous advantages, but it's crucial to understand the potential costs involved. Oracle databases are frequently used in mission-critical applications, and their deployment to AWS requires careful planning to minimize expenses.

One key factor is selecting the right AWS service for your Oracle workload. Different options like Amazon EC2, RDS for Oracle, or Oracle Cloud Infrastructure (OCI) have varying pricing here structures.

Evaluate factors such as compute demands, storage space, and network throughput. Additionally, utilizing cost-optimization strategies like Reserved Resources or Spot Instances can significantly lower your overall cloud spending.

Regularly monitoring your AWS costs and modifying your infrastructure as needed is essential for maintaining budget control.
